The untold stories of how founders shape culture and why it matters more than ever.

Launched in 2022, The Soul of Startups has since made waves across the startup and business world from being Barnes & Noble’s Book of the Month in early 2023, to being featured in over 100 podcasts, cited by Forbes, and highlighted by global media including Business Insider, Yahoo Finance, Sifted, and Money20/20.

This book is more than a leadership book.
It’s a raw, honest look into the emotional backbone of startups their culture and how much of it is shaped (and sometimes broken) by the people who start them.

Why I wrote it?

This book is close to my heart as I have had to draw from my unique experience to pull this together, and I am proud to share this story with you.

After years of building, coaching, and fixing startup cultures around the world, I kept seeing the same truth:

Founders don’t just build companies. They embed their beliefs, wounds, and blind spots into them.

The Soul of Startups is my attempt to bring these invisible forces into the light to help founders become more conscious of their impact, and to help teams survive the rollercoaster of startup life without losing themselves.

What you will Learn?

  • How a founder’s personality silently shapes the culture of a company

  • The early warning signs of cultural toxicity and what to do about them

  • Stories of real startups navigating ego, burnout, purpose, and people

  • Practical frameworks to build culture with intention from Day 1
